1. Terrible loss no doubt. The game was won, and then they pulled a game 2 on us. Our guys started without the necessary energy/focus, then locked in, then unlocked out. Maxey made some crazy shots, but Embiid was a no show and we blew it for sure.
2. Mitch was great before the last couple possessions. Obviously he made the wrong choices there to finish, but he shouldnt have even been in at that point.
3. Jalen scored, but I still dont like the constant isos to end games with no passing. This is Thibs’ offense however.
4. OG and Deuce are playing well, so Jalen needs to look for them more. They should be taking 15 shots a game at minimum. OG has to be more assertive too. Deuce is rightfully playing more than Donte now.
5. Donte has been subpar this series, but maybe try running some stuff for him to get open. Most of his 3s were heavily contested. Regardless, he has to wake up asap and find a way to contribute more.
6. Precious should have played.
7. Josh is awesome at what he does well, but he has gone cold from deep again. They’re leaving him wide open all game.
8. Isaiah swished a jumpshot and went 4-4 from the stripe. He should take a J here and there.
9. It’s not easy to close teams out. Learning experience. Last year we took Miami to 6. Boston took us to 6 in 2013 and then we took Indiana to 6 in the next round. All people will remember is who wins the series.
10. Two more tries to take one. We’ll do it.

Mistakes were made throughout the game. I don’t think it is fair to put it all on Robinson. We lost this game on the offensive end. Missed free throws, bad turnovers were all a problem. Brunson was great most of the game but he had some really bad turnovers including forced passes to iHart and Hart in two different possessions. Earlier OG’s pass to Mitchell under the basket was a blunder too. You can’t expect him to catch that ball. And how about that unnecessary fast break pass attempt to OG that caused another turnover? Offense was chaotic much of the game. Ball didn’t move to the right spots. There were lots of easy opportunities that we passed on. I put a lot on Thibs. He should have done a better job calming things down. I get that we are short handed but he should have expanded the roster to give short breaks. Most of the mistakes were due to exhaustion. You could see that very clearly.
